Correct answer: [tex]y = 3x -5[/tex]

You don't have to use the whole table in order to find equation. You can use just two points on the table to start.

In order to find the slope, the formula for that is: [tex]\frac{y_{2}-y_{1}}{x_{2} - x_{1}}[/tex]. So, we can start with points (1, -2) and (2, 1). Label (1, -2) as [tex]x_{1}[/tex] and [tex]y_{1}[/tex]; label (2, 1) as [tex]x_{2}[/tex] and [tex]y_{2}[/tex]. Now we can plug the numbers into the formula.

[tex]\frac{1-(-2)}{2 - 1}[/tex] → [tex]\frac{3}{1}[/tex] → [tex]3[/tex] is the slope.

To find the y-intercept, substitute (1, -2) into [tex]y = 3x + b[/tex].

[tex](-2) = 3(1) + b[/tex]

[tex]-2 = 3 + b[/tex]

[tex]-3[/tex]   [tex]-3[/tex]

________

[tex]b = -5[/tex] is the y-intercept.

Thus, the slope-intercept equation is [tex]y = 3x -5[/tex]. Hope this helps :) Let me know if you have any other questions related to this problem!

determine the discount between the point(-4,2) and the line 4y=3×+6​

Answers

Answer:

d = 14/5

Step-by-step explanation:

The point (-4,2) means that;

At x = -4, y = 2

Now general form of a linear equation is;

Ax + By + C = 0

We are given;

4y = 3x + 6​

Rearranging to the form of a linear equation gives;

3x - 4y + 6 = 0

Thus, A = 3, B = -4 and C = 6

Thus, at point (-4,2), distance between them is;

d = (3(-4) - 4(2) + 6)/√(3² + (-4)²)

d = -14/5

We will take the absolute value.

Thus; d = 14/5

a cashier at the supermarket has $685 in 4 different denomination bills in her register at the end of the day. the number of $5 bills was 10 more than 4 times the amount of $10 bills. the register contained as many $1 bills as $5 bills and $10 bills combined, and two $50 bills. how many bills of each kind did the register contain?

Answers

9514 1404 393

Answer:

85 ones70 fives15 tens2 fifties

Step-by-step explanation:

Let a, b, c, d represent the numbers of $1, $5, $10, and $50 bills, respectively. The problem statement tells us ...

  a +5b +10c +50d = 685 . . . . . total amount of cash

  b = 10 +4c . . . . . . . . . . . . the number of fives is 10 more than 4 times tens

  a = b+c . . . . . . . . . . . as many ones as fives and tens combined

  d = 2 . . . . . . . . . . the register contained 2 fifty-dollar bills

__

Substituting for 'a', then for 'b', we have ...

  (b+c) +5b +10c +50d = 685

  6(10 +4c) +11c +50d = 685

  60 +35c +50d = 685

Substituting d=2 and subtracting 160 gives ...

  35c = 525

  c = 15

  b = 10 +4c = 10 +4(15) = 70

  a = b+c = 70 +15 = 85

The register contained ...

85 ones70 fives15 tens2 fifties
